SATT OUEST VALORISATION : revenue, balance sheet and financial ratios
SATT OUEST VALORISATION is a French company
founded 13 years ago,
specialized in the sector Activités spécialisées, scientifiques et techniques diverses.
Based in RENNES (35700),
this company of category PME
shows in 2024 a revenue of 3.4 M€.

Revenue and income statement
In 2024, SATT OUEST VALORISATION achieves revenue of 3.4 M€. Over the period 2016-2024, the company shows strong growth with a CAGR (compound annual growth rate) of +6.2%. Vs 2023: +6%. After deducting consumption (0 €), gross margin stands at 3.4 M€, i.e. a rate of 100%. This ratio measures the ability to generate value from commercial activity. EBITDA (= Gross margin - Personnel expenses - Taxes) reaches -6.6 M€, representing -194.9% of revenue. Warning negative scissor effect: despite revenue change (+6%), EBITDA varies by -38%, reducing margin by 44.9 pts. This reflects costs rising faster than revenue. Negative EBITDA means operations do not cover current expenses: concerning situation. Ultimately, net income (= EBIT +/- financial result +/- exceptional - corporate tax) amounts to 698 k€, i.e. 20.6% of revenue. This profit can be retained or distributed to shareholders.

Solvency and debt ratios
The debt ratio (= Financial debt / Equity x 100) stands at 2187%. Critical situation: debt significantly exceeds equity, severely limiting borrowing capacity and exposing the company to default risk. Financial autonomy (= Equity / Total assets x 100) reaches 3%. Low autonomy: the company heavily depends on external financing (banks, suppliers). Debt repayment capacity (= Financial debt / Cash flow) indicates it would take 9.5 years of cash flow to repay all financial debt. Beyond 7 years, banks generally consider credit risk as high. Cash flow represents 62.8% of revenue. Cash flow measures resources generated by operations, available for investment and debt repayment. This high level provides strong self-financing capacity.

Working capital requirement (WCR) and payment terms
Working capital requirement (WCR) measures the cash timing gap between customer collections and supplier/inventory payments. Average customer payment term: 303 days (formula: Customer receivables / Revenue incl. VAT x 360). Supplier term: 163 days. The gap of 140 days means the company finances its customers for over a month before being paid relative to supplier payments. This weighs on cash flow. Inventory turnover is 2946 days (= Average inventory / Cost of goods x 360). This high level ties up cash and potentially creates obsolescence risk. Overall, WCR represents 2184 days of revenue, i.e. 20.6 M€ to permanently finance. Over 2016-2024, WCR increased by +93%, requiring additional financing.
